A new concept was introduced into my world of late, one that I am enjoying dancing with as I do my best to achieve health and career goals.
The idea - when thinking of a goal you want to achieve, do not think of what you need to do to achieve it. Rather, think of what you will give up to achieve it.
I gave up eating after 6 pm (so I can achieve the 12-hour fast recommended by the LifestyleRx program I am part of). This one act alone brought down my morning blood sugars dramatically.
I gave up my couch, trading mindless hours of video viewing for reading and moving.
I gave up chips and snacking in the evening (again, 12-hour fast).
In other words, I gave up things that were NOT helping me achieve my goals and as a result ... I am.
